Emerging Trends Shaping Cross-Platform Data Integration
Recent advances in data management frameworks are redefining how digital publishers operate. Key trends include:
- Unified Data Ecosystems: Bringing together siloed data sources to create a comprehensive user profile, enabling personalized experiences that increase engagement and loyalty.
- Adoption of AI and Machine Learning: Leveraging AI-driven analytics to predict content preferences and streamline ad targeting across multiple channels.
- Decentralization and Privacy Focus: Emphasizing privacy-preserving data techniques such as federated learning and differential privacy, crucial under evolving regulatory regimes like GDPR and CCPA.

Strategic Considerations for Future-Proof Data Infrastructure
As digital ecosystems become more complex, future-proofing data architectures involves several critical considerations:
- Interoperability: Choosing platforms that seamlessly integrate with existing tools and support open data standards.
- Scalability: Ensuring infrastructure can handle increasing data volumes without compromising performance.
- Security and Compliance: Prioritizing security features and compliance mechanisms to protect user privacy and meet regulatory requirements.
